Northumberland Ferries troubles could run into Tuesday

Reduced crossings on Northumberland Ferries between P.E.I. and Nova Scotia are expected to continue into Tuesday.

MV Confederation down since Sunday

Reduced crossings on Northumberland Ferries between P.E.I. and Nova Scotia are expected to continue into Tuesday.

MV Confederation was tied up with electrical problems Sunday, and technicians have been unable to solve the problem. A technician from Quebec is expected to be on board Tuesday to work on it.

The technical issue caused cancellations on Sunday and Monday.

The service has been operating with the MV Holiday Island only. On Monday there were five round-trip sailings scheduled, leaving from Wood Islands, P.E.I., at 6:30 a.m., 9:30 a.m., 1 p.m., 4:30 p.m.and 7:30 p.m. Crossings from Caribou, N.S., were at 8 a.m., 11:15 a.m., 2:45 p.m., 6 p.m. and 9 p.m.
